Почему Version.Minor ОС Windows Phone 7.1 "10"? - PullRequest
0 голосов
/ 04 августа 2011

Телефон Mango (Windows Phone 7.5 / Windows Phone OS 7.1), который у меня под рукой, говорит «7. 10 .XXXX», когда я выполнил следующий код:

System.Environment.OSVersion.Version.ToString()

Я ожидал "7. 1 .XXXX".

Почему младший номер версии (второе число) "10" (не "1")?

Существует ли какое-либо соглашение о том, чтобы интерпретировать "10" как "1" ???

1 Ответ

2 голосов
/ 29 октября 2011

Я не слышал ни о каком таком соглашении;Чтобы уточнить, вот как я это понимаю:

  • На потребительском / маркетинговом рынке Windows Phone Mango - это Windows Phone 7.5.
  • На земле разработчика сборки - это Windows Phone 7.1,и что более важно, SDK равен 7.1
  • В OS Build land 7.10.7720.68 - это RTM Mango.

Сказав, что вы можете приравнять 7.10.7720 к Mango / 7.1 / 7.5- но 7.10.8200 был замечен в дикой природе, но не подтвержден, будь то Танго или Манго.

Чтобы ответить на ваш вопрос : Уверен, нет никакого соглашения, чтобы читать 10 как 1.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...